Smile 47 Tuc from October

G'day all,

The weekend before my wedding in October last year I spent at Astro Camp. Got lots of good shots that weekend, Tuc 47, Horsehad & Flame, Fornax galaxy cluster. I don't think I have posted any of them here, I certainly hadn't processed 47 Tuc and still haven't processed Horsehead & Flame. Only just nw getting around to making the time for it.

I quite like this shot of 47 Tuc. I think some people will have something to say about the colour, but for now I don't mind it how it is. The sharpness is good, although I did debate cecreasing the curves slightly to hide the fainter background stars that look more like noise.

I like that it has a couple of other clusters visible in the bottom right and that they have some colour variation. I haven't tried to particularly bring them out in the processing, I could probably make them better if I did.
